Output 332dab67a7ce209f1a782e9745a5aac32b88d37b36c96c66b914ae5f1ea96903:9

value
181000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b38a937eddd3464aee60e2fba2bda1226d4683ec OP_EQUAL
address
3J4LtKbVy5vtvKEn2BQPbZAR7HvqhQgxha
transaction
332dab67a7ce209f1a782e9745a5aac32b88d37b36c96c66b914ae5f1ea96903
spent
true